A Detailed Look at the Itinerary
Starting Point at the Tour Magne
The adventure begins in front of the Tour Magne, a Roman monument that’s impossible to miss. It’s a familiar sight, but the guide’s focus isn’t just on its architecture—it’s on the stories behind it. Guests report that guides often share hidden legends and local customs that you wouldn’t find in a standard tour. It’s a perfect way to set the tone for an experience that’s both fun and informative.
Passing the Vineyard and Jardin de La Fontaine
Next, the tour takes you past a vintage vineyard, which isn’t just a scenic stop but a nod to the city’s historic connection to winemaking and local agriculture. The visit to Jardin de La Fontaine is a highlight—it’s more than just a beautiful park. Expect stories about its creation and the traditions tied to the space, often accompanied by insights into how locals have used these green spaces for generations.

Throughout the walk, you’ll enjoy gourmet surprises—from brandade, a creamy salted cod dish, to picholine olives and chestnut biscuits. Reviewers like Daniela from Italy highlight how these tastings are woven seamlessly into the story, turning the walk into a sensory journey. Passing by Local Shops and Hidden Corners
The tour includes visits to local shops where you can pick up cookies or regional snacks to take home, adding a tangible memory of your visit. These moments also reveal local customs and craftsmanship, giving you insight into the city’s daily life beyond tourist hotspots.
The Final Stop at the Arènes de Nîmes
The walk concludes at the Arènes de Nîmes, one of the city’s most iconic Roman sites. While the arena itself is well-known, your guide will share lesser-known stories—like tales of historic gladiatorial games, as well as local legends connected to the structure. Guests note that the storytelling here feels personal and engaging, making the visit more than just a photo opportunity.

FAQ
Is the tour suitable for non-French speakers?
The tour is conducted in French only, so a basic understanding or translation aid will help you fully enjoy the experience. However, the guide’s enthusiasm and storytelling style make it enjoyable even if your French isn’t fluent.
How long does the tour last?
It lasts approximately 1.5 hours, making it a perfect short activity to fit into a day of sightseeing.
What is included in the price?
The price covers the guided walk and local tastings such as brandade, olives, and biscuits. You also get to explore sites like the Jardin de La Fontaine and the Arènes de Nîmes.
Is the tour accessible for wheelchairs?
Yes, the tour is wheelchair accessible, making it inclusive for a broader range of guests.
Do I need to reserve in advance?
Yes, reservations are recommended. You can cancel up to 24 hours before for a full refund, offering flexibility in your plans.
Are there any hidden costs?
No, the listed price is all-inclusive for the tour and tastings. Additional purchases, like souvenirs from local shops, are optional.
What should I bring?
Bring water, comfortable shoes, and an open mind. Wearing sun protection is advisable during summer visits.
